Simultaneous Keypad Dialling

You can use the base unit like a standard telephone. After pressing (TALK) to make a call with the handset near the base unit, you can also dial using the base unit keypad.

1

Handset:

 

Press (TALK).

(TALK)

2

Base unit:

 

Dial a telephone number while

 

 

hearing a dial tone on the

 

 

handset.

 

 

When the other party answers, talk

 

 

using the handset.

 

3

Handset:

 

To hang up, press (TALK) or

 

place the handset on the base unit.

Basic Operation

Simultaneous Keypad Dialling is only possible after pressing (TALK).

Useful information

You can enter numbers using the base unit keypad during a call with the handset. For example, to access an answering service, electronic banking service, etc.

1.Handset: Press (TALK).

2.Handset:

Dial a telephone number.

You can also dial with the base unit keypad.

3.Base unit:

Enter the required numbers while listening to the pre-recorded instructions.

4.Handset:

To hang up, press (TALK) or place the handset on the base unit.
